Description soldatov 2015-05-13 13:40:02 UTC
On our Solaris machine this test fails in ~100% cases. Manually I see this problem in ~25-50% cases.

Scenario:
- Launch NetBeans with fresh userdir
- Create Pi sample
- Select "Pthreads_safe" configuration
- Open pi_pthreads_correct.c file in editor
- Set line breakpoint at 54th line
- Push Debug Project button
- Open Debugging Views tab
==> I see "Java Project" listbox (but my IDE has not Java plug-in) and empty content

Workaround: restart IDE
